Aged Care Code

By Steven Paull

A new Code of Conduct for Aged Care has been introduced. All providers delivering NDIS supports to participants have been required to comply with the NDIS Code of Conduct since 1 July 2018, and that requirement is not changing.

Providers and workers delivering both aged care services and NDIS supports will be required to comply with both the Aged Care Code and the NDIS Code. However, as the Aged Care Code is based on the NDIS Code, with slight differences in language and definitions that are specific to each sector, the obligations are largely the same.
